I'd love the rebels to win, but any rebel group that can't "liberate" an airfield, tank depot, or armory (esprecialy the armory) in the first day deserves to lose. They don't have to hold the place, just take what you can and wreck the rest.
The rebels did liberate the airfields, tank depots and major armories in Benghazi and Tobruk by early March. The problem is that these airfields, armories and depots had the older, more obsolete equipment (a by-product of Gadhaffi's favoritism of western Libya and the concentration of his best military units around Tripoli), which put them at a disadvantage in terms of firepower from the start.
